Beachwood Animal Clinic in New Smyrna Beach, FL is hiring a full-time Associate Veterinarian to join our friendly, client-focused practice. We provide high-quality, compassionate care for dogs, cats, and select exotics in a supportive, team-oriented environment.

What you'll do

  • Provide medical, surgical, and preventative care for canine, feline, and small exotic patients
  • Diagnose and treat illnesses; perform routine and elective surgeries
  • Counsel clients on preventive care, nutrition, behavior, and follow-up care
  • Maintain accurate medical records and collaborate with team members on case management
  • Participate in after-hours rotation (shared) and occasional on-call duties
